Hiya, hope my ask finds you well!
In light of somereaderinblue’s prior ask on how Smokescreen would react to Ratchet using Synth–En (the way he brushes it off with a light reassurance was just heartbreaking, by the way), I can’t help but imagine his (+Wheeljack’s) reaction to Arcee, Bulkhead, and Bumblebee pointing their blasters at Optimus in Nemesis Prime.
I know you haven’t watched TFP in a while, but it always bothered me that Team Prime couldn’t seem to differentiate between Optimus and Nemesis Prime. Makeshift’s case was different, because he imitated Wheeljack’s appearance to a T. But Nemesis Prime?
I get it, it was nighttime, and there’s no way they could tell it wasn’t Optimus from paintjob alone. But despite Bulkhead’s reluctance and Arcee’s “Primes don’t run” comment, they were still wary of him (also, for a bot quick on her pedes, the way Arcee just stood there and basically allowed Nemesis Prime to run her over…oof).
And then came the scene where the trio pointed their blasters at Optimus.
This is jarring. Are you telling me, that the same bots that stood by Optimus’ side this whole time didn’t at least try to thoroughly question his identity and whereabouts beforehand? Someone pointed out that this is post–Orion Pax where everyone (except Ratchet and Jack, apparently) may have trust issues, but still, Optimus’ hurt look was devastating.
At least Ratchet was quick to question them (he should’ve been livid that they literally and figuratively jumped the gun, in my opinion), even Jack said, “Come on, it’s our guy. Can’t you tell?”.
I think I saw a reblog (kzele’s, I believe) where Smokescreen would’ve called out Makeshift’s bluff. If he were in Nemesis Prime, he’d be appalled at the accusations and would physically shield Optimus from the others’ blasters. It’d add up to the trend where Smokescreen would literally and figuratively become Optimus shield, shown in Alpha Omega (shielded Optimus from Megatron’s dark star saber) and in Darkest Hour (defended Optimus’ decision against Ratchet). It’s a minor detail, but I like it, since it’s a nod to his status as an Elite Guard.

Hey there! I'm doing well, thank you!
I'm glad you liked the ask (it was an "ow" line in hindsight, but Smokescreen's the type of guy to downplay those things), and that's an excellent point.
I do remember...the latter half of Nemesis Prime, and looking back on it, that was a WILD episode. Optimus' supposed close friends/family holding him at gunpoint was a bull choice in the writers' room. Yes, they just got shaken, but how poorly do they know Optimus to just pull iron on him so fast? (Sidenote, but Arcee's word should mean jack squat given the Speed Metal situation; she has obscured the truth in the past.)
Even when I first watched it, my immediate thought was essentially "this dude's got yellow eyes, how can you not tell it's a fake?!" Nighttime is one thing, especially in a location as un-light polluted as Jasper/Nevada is. But the eyes?!?!
Arcee, are YOU blind? (I don't remember her letting Nemesis do that, but I guess that reinforces my question.)
Wait...the Orion Pax arc is what causes "trust issues"?
Like....what excuse is that?!
Optimus got laser-guided divine amnesia, how does that result in everybody having trouble with trust? If it were in the wake of Con Job, sure, but the Orion Pax arc?
Lord, give me patience, because if You give me strength, I'm gonna need a lawyer.
Moving on, because right now I don't wanna dignify that revelation anymore than I already have, Optimus had every right to be hurt. The guys he's fought side by side with for centuries or more just do that with zero hesitation? I'd blow a gasket if I were in his place!
Oh. Oh crap, I never considered that Smokescreen was Optimus' shield - you're a genius!!!
Elite Guardsmen are the protectors of not just Cybertron, but the Prime as well. Smokescreen admiring Optimus isn't just who he is (which makes half the fandom Guardsmen too), it's him staying true to his training and position in the Cybertronian hierarchy!
Yes, you and Kzele are right: Smokescreen would call the bluff/scheme immediately, and set to work figuring out how to undo the damage. I love the little snippet you wrote (I don't think I have the current mental capacity to write anything about that though, RIP me), and I feel you did Wheeljack well. He's not a detective, but he's definitely a hunter. Give him a trail and a suspicious story, and he'll hunt down the perpetrator.
Now that you mention it, the whole reason Smokescreen and Wheeljack were kept so far away/unscheduled is probably because of how fast the show would end otherwise. We've talked about how Smokescreen just zoomed through plots that the others struggled with, and Wheeljack almost took down freaking Soundwave. Add in how Miko killed Hardshell, and the trio would've ended things sooner. Smokey and Wheeljack would assuredly have challenged the status quo of the series - maybe even changed some of the setup.
